Gout Relief: Strategies to End Recurring Flare-Ups
Dealing with frequent gout flare-ups can be painful, but there are effective strategies you can employ to control their occurrence. Primarily, modifying your diet is essential; this often means restricting intake of purine-rich foods like organ meats and alcohol. Maintaining adequate fluid levels also plays a vital role in flushing uric acid from your system. Beyond lifestyle changes, considering medication options with your doctor – such as allopurinol or febuxostat to lower uric acid levels – may be advised for some individuals. Finally, achieving a ideal weight and addressing other related health problems, like high blood pressure, can further help you minimize those agonizing gout attacks.

Prevent This Condition in Its Wake: Proven Methods for Reducing
Successfully managing gout involves proactive steps . Focusing on a diet low in purines – found abundantly in rich foods like steak, liver, and shellfish – is important. Staying adequately watered by drinking plenty of water daily helps eliminate uric acid. Keeping a healthy physique through regular workouts is also key, as obesity significantly elevates susceptibility. Consulting with your doctor about medications that lower uric acid levels can be beneficial , especially for those at high risk or experiencing frequent flares . Finally, remember to avoid alcohol consumption, particularly beer and spirits as it can significantly exacerbate symptoms .
